Choosing the Right Coilovers for Your E46: A Buyer's Guide

Selecting perfect coilovers for your E46 BMW is a significant task, given the extensive range of options present. Evaluate your intended use first; are you mainly pursuing track performance, street use, or a combination of both? Budget is the important factor; coilovers range significantly in price. Typically, higher-end coilovers feature sophisticated shock absorber technology and tuneable elements, permitting for greater control over ride height.

Here's a brief look to help you:

  • Road-focused Coilovers: Offer a pleasant ride for daily use while yet increasing handling.
  • Track-oriented Coilovers: Designed for optimal grip on the racetrack, sacrificing some daily drivability.
  • Adjustable Coilovers: Let you to fine-tune the suspension characteristics to suit your requirements.
  • Spring Rate Considerations: Stiffer spring rates increase handling responsiveness but lessen ride comfort.

Lastly, explore different brands and examine testimonials before choosing your investment. Remember to ensure fitment with your specific E46 model.

Lowering Your E46: Coilovers vs. Springs

So, you're wanting lower the stance of your E46? Excellent! You've got a couple of options: coilovers or springs . Performance springs are typically the more budget-friendly choice , and offer a noticeable change in appearance. They’re relatively easy to install , but give limited adjustability. Adjustable suspension systems , on the flip side, are a higher-end investment , allowing you to fine-tune your ride characteristics and get a genuinely look . They usually demand expert installation . Ultimately, the ideal path relies on your finances and intended extent of handling .

  • Springs: Budget-friendly, easier setup, limited adjustability.
  • Coilovers: Greater adjustability, higher price , qualified fitting suggested .
